Abstract

The article is devoted to the identification of clinical and pathological features of parents/caregivers of patients with anorexia nervosa. The study included 110 patients, including 47 (42.7 %) men (fathers of patients with AN) and 63 (57.3 %) women (mothers of patients with AN). The mean age of the subjects was M=44.90 (SD=5.9; SE=0.567), the minimum age was 34 years, the maximum age was 63 years. The following methods were used in the study: DERS emotional regulation difficulty scale, Toronto Alexithymia Scale TAS-26, Hospital Anxiety and Depression Scale (HADS). The DERS scale revealed a relatively pronounced manifestation in the subscales characterizing difficulties in behavior related to goal achievement (19.13 points out of 25 possible) and impulsivity of emotional manifestations (24.17 points out of 30 possible). This combination mainly characterizes a person as unable to make an informed decision, acts spontaneously when experiencing negative emotions, and other subscale scores are above average, indicating problems with emotional regulation in this group of subjects. The results obtained by the TAS methodology showed that the average group indicator of the study group is 80.45 (SD=13.699), which characterizes the average type of the studied individuals as alexithymic. The analysis of the results obtained by the indicators of the HADS methodology revealed that the average values are equal to: on the anxiety scale M=7.96 (SD=1.347), on the depression scale M=7.95 (SD=1.442). According to the assessment criteria of the methodology, these indicators can be considered as the extreme limit of the norm or subclinically expressed anxiety and depression. The obtained results emphasize the need for further development of differentiated measures for the correction and prevention of clinical and pathological disorders in parents/caregivers of patients with AN by improving the levels of emotional regulation, alexithymia, anxiety and depression.
